2025-03-20x86: hyperv: Add mshv_handler() irq handler and setup functionNuno Das Neves
Add mshv_handler() to process messages related to managing guest partitions such as intercepts, doorbells, and scheduling messages. In a (non-nested) root partition, the same interrupt vector is shared between the vmbus and mshv_root drivers. Introduce a stub for mshv_handler() and call it in sysvec_hyperv_callback alongside vmbus_handler(). Even though both handlers will be called for every Hyper-V interrupt, the messages for each driver are delivered to different offsets within the SYNIC message page, so they won't step on each other. 2025-03-20x86/hyperv: Add VTL mode callback for restarting the systemRoman Kisel
The kernel runs as a firmware in the VTL mode, and the only way to restart in the VTL mode on x86 is to triple fault. Thus, one has to always supply "reboot=t" on the kernel command line in the VTL mode, and missing that renders rebooting not working. Define the machine restart callback to always use the triple fault to provide the robust configuration by default. 2025-03-20x86/hyperv: Add VTL mode emergency restart callbackRoman Kisel
By default, X86(-64) systems use the emergecy restart routine in the course of which the code unconditionally writes to the physical address of 0x472 to indicate the boot mode to the firmware (BIOS or UEFI). When the kernel itself runs as a firmware in the VTL mode, that write corrupts the memory of the guest upon emergency restarting. Preserving the state intact in that situation is important for debugging, at least. Define the specialized machine callback to avoid that write and use the triple fault to perform emergency restart. 2025-03-20hyperv: Add CONFIG_MSHV_ROOT to gate root partition supportNuno Das Neves
CONFIG_MSHV_ROOT allows kernels built to run as a normal Hyper-V guest to exclude the root partition code, which is expected to grow significantly over time. This option is a tristate so future driver code can be built as a (m)odule, allowing faster development iteration cycles. If CONFIG_MSHV_ROOT is disabled, don't compile hv_proc.c, and stub hv_root_partition() to return false unconditionally. This allows the compiler to optimize away root partition code blocks since they will be disabled at compile time. In the case of booting as root partition *without* CONFIG_MSHV_ROOT enabled, print a critical error (the kernel will likely crash). 2025-03-20Merge branch 'kvm-nvmx-and-vm-teardown' into HEADPaolo Bonzini
The immediate issue being fixed here is a nVMX bug where KVM fails to detect that, after nested VM-Exit, L1 has a pending IRQ (or NMI). However, checking for a pending interrupt accesses the legacy PIC, and x86's kvm_arch_destroy_vm() currently frees the PIC before destroying vCPUs, i.e. checking for IRQs during the forced nested VM-Exit results in a NULL pointer deref; that's a prerequisite for the nVMX fix. The remaining patches attempt to bring a bit of sanity to x86's VM teardown code, which has accumulated a lot of cruft over the years. E.g. KVM currently unloads each vCPU's MMUs in a separate operation from destroying vCPUs, all because when guest SMP support was added, KVM had a kludgy MMU teardown flow that broke when a VM had more than one 1 vCPU. 2025-03-20ASoC: wm8904: Add DMIC and DRC supportMark Brown
Merge series from Francesco Dolcini <francesco@dolcini.it>: This patch series adds DMIC and DRC support to the WM8904 driver, a new of_ helper is added to simplify the driver code. DRC functionality is added in the same patch series to provide the necessary dynamic range control to make DMIC support useful. The WM8904 supports digital microphones on two of its inputs: IN1L/DMICDAT1 and IN1R/DMICDAT2. These two inputs can either be connected to an ADC or to the DMIC system. There is an ADC for each line, and only one DMIC block. This DMIC block is either connected to DMICDAT1 or to DMICDAT2. One DMIC data line supports two digital microphones via time multiplexing. The pin's functionality is decided during hardware design (IN1L vs DMICDAT1 and IN1R vs DMICDAT2). This is reflected in the Device Tree. If one line is analog and one is DMIC, we need to be able to switch between ADC and DMIC at runtime. The DMIC source is known from the Device Tree. If both are DMIC inputs, we need to be able to switch the DMIC source. There is no need to switch between ADC and DMIC at runtime. Therefore, kcontrols are dynamically added by the driver depending on its Device Tree configuration. 2025-03-20Merge patch series "pidfs: handle multi-threaded exec and premature ↵Christian Brauner
thread-group leader exit" Christian Brauner <brauner@kernel.org> says: This is another attempt at trying to make pidfd polling for multi-threaded exec and premature thread-group leader exit consistent. A quick recap of these two cases: (1) During a multi-threaded exec by a subthread, i.e., non-thread-group leader thread, all other threads in the thread-group including the thread-group leader are killed and the struct pid of the thread-group leader will be taken over by the subthread that called exec. IOW, two tasks change their TIDs. (2) A premature thread-group leader exit means that the thread-group leader exited before all of the other subthreads in the thread-group have exited. Both cases lead to inconsistencies for pidfd polling with PIDFD_THREAD. Any caller that holds a PIDFD_THREAD pidfd to the current thread-group leader may or may not see an exit notification on the file descriptor depending on when poll is performed. If the poll is performed before the exec of the subthread has concluded an exit notification is generated for the old thread-group leader. If the poll is performed after the exec of the subthread has concluded no exit notification is generated for the old thread-group leader. The correct behavior would be to simply not generate an exit notification on the struct pid of a subhthread exec because the struct pid is taken over by the subthread and thus remains alive. But this is difficult to handle because a thread-group may exit premature as mentioned in (2). In that case an exit notification is reliably generated but the subthreads may continue to run for an indeterminate amount of time and thus also may exec at some point. This tiny series tries to address this problem. If that works correctly then no exit notifications are generated for a PIDFD_THREAD pidfd for a thread-group leader until all subthreads have been reaped.
